Determining Death by Neurological Criteria : Current Practice and Ethics
The neurological criteria for the determination of death remain controversial within secular and Catholic circles, even though they are widely accepted within the medical community.In Determining Death by Neurological Criteria, Matthew Hanley offers both a practical and a philosophical defense.Hanley shows that the criteria are often misapplied in clinical settings, leading to cases where persons declared dead apparently spontaneously revive.These instances are often connected to a rushed decision to retrieve donated organs, thus undermining the trust of the public in organ donation.Hanley calls on health care institutions to take seriously their obligation to establish strict protocols for the determination of death, including who may conduct the examinations. From a broader perspective, Hanley considers how the criteria rely on a philosophical conception of the person as a living organism whose unity disintegrates at death.This view, he notes, corresponds to the Catholic conviction that the soul is the life-principle of the body, which departs at death, bringing about the destruction of the body-soul composite.The Vatican, recognizing that death is a medical judgment, has generally given its approval to the criteria.Hanley also reviews the many and various objections offered by detractors, including against the use of the apnea test, which is faulted as a practice that sometimes hastens death.The problem of the continued presence of certain vital functions within the deceased body of the brain dead is explored in detail, with reference to particular cases and to solutions proposed by leading physicians and bioethicists.Hanley likewise addresses the dilemma of having two separate standards for death, one neurological and the other cardiopulmonary.Given the possibility of resuscitation following loss of the cardio-circulatory system, he concludes that the neurological criteria must be the true standard.Stoppage of the heart leads swiftly to the final necrosis of the brain.

What Kind of Death : The Ethics of Determining One’s Own Death
Many books have been published about physician-assisted death.This book offers a comprehensive and in-depth examination of that subject, but it also extends the discussion to a broader range of end-of-life decisions including suicide, palliative care and sedation until death.In every jurisdiction that has laws permitting some kind of physician-assisted death, a central point of controversy is whether such assistance should only be available to dying patients, or to everyone who wants to end his life.The right to determine the manner and time of one’s own death, however, does not necessarily mean that physicians should be permitted to cooperate in ensuring a quick and peaceful death.In this book, Govert den Hartogh considers the fundamental and practical matters – including concrete issues of legal regulation – related to end-of life decision making.He proposes a two-tiered system. Everyone should have access to humane means of ending his life, if his decision to end it is voluntary, well-considered and durable.But doctors should only participate in a joint action of ending the patient’s life on his request if they also are convinced of acting in the patient’s best interests, in particular by ending intolerable and unrelievable suffering. And perhaps there is reason to restrict that second service to dying patients.The whole argument, however, depends on the extent to which, in both tiers of the system, we can design legal safeguards that will enable us to trust judgments about the requesting person’s request and about his suffering.The book considers much new evidence in regard to this issue. What Kind of Death will appeal to researchers and advanced students working in bioethics, applied ethics, philosophy of law and health law.

Determining Sample Size and Power in Research Studies : A Manual for Researchers
This book addresses sample size and power in the context of research, offering valuable insights for graduate and doctoral students as well as researchers in any discipline where data is generated to investigate research questions.It explains how to enhance the authenticity of research by estimating the sample size and reporting the power of the tests used.Further, it discusses the issue of sample size determination in survey studies as well as in hypothesis testing experiments so that readers can grasp the concept of statistical errors, minimum detectable difference, effect size, one-tail and two-tail tests and the power of the test.The book also highlights the importance of fixing these boundary conditions in enhancing the authenticity of research findings and improving the chances of research papers being accepted by respected journals.Further, it explores the significance of sample size by showing the power achieved in selected doctoral studies.Procedure has been discussed to fix power in the hypothesis testing experiment.One should usually have power at least 0.8 in the study because having power less than this will have the issue of practical significance of findings.If the power in any study is less than 0.5 then it would be better to test the hypothesis by tossing a coin instead of organizing the experiment.It also discusses determining sample size and power using the freeware G*Power software, based on twenty-one examples using different analyses, like t-test, parametric and non-parametric correlations, multivariate regression, logistic regression, independent and repeated measures ANOVA, mixed design, MANOVA and chi-square.
